Meaning of loot rail | Babel Free

Noun CEFR B2

Definitions

The light rail system of Baltimore, regarded as a means for inner-city criminals to visit other districts to commit robbery.

US, derogatory, slang, uncountable

Examples

“The idea held great promise. […] So citizens said yes. But that was a year ago, before inner-city troubles arrived on the boxy white train with a blue stripe, before light rail became known as "loot rail."”
“[…] has launched the anti-“loot rail” movement as it has named itself as a play on “light rail,” but such fears are unwarranted and most thieves have access to automobiles.”
